  1. Malcolm-Jamal Warner (born August 18, 1970) is an American actor. He rose to prominence for his role as Theodore Huxtable on the NBC sitcom The Cosby Show, which earned him a nomination for Outstanding Supporting Actor in a Comedy Series at the 38th Primetime Emmy Awards.

  3. Malcolm-Jamal Warner (born August 18, 1970, Jersey City, New Jersey, U.S.) American actor, director, and musician who is perhaps best known for his work on The Cosby Show (1984–92), one of the most popular sitcoms in television history. He also is a noted spoken-word artist.
